This article discusses the growing interest among former and current NFL players in using psychedelics, to address the neurological and psychological impacts of repeated head trauma and concussions. While scientific research into psychedelics for traumatic brain injury is still in its early stages, with most studies focusing on mental health, athletes like Jordan Poyer report anecdotal benefits including improved well-being and a belief in their ability to heal brain injuries. The article also touches on the potential mechanisms of action, such as neuroplasticity and anti-inflammatory effects, and highlights the challenges of clinical research. Despite the lack of definitive human data and the risks of self-medication, there is optimism among some researchers that future studies could validate the therapeutic potential of psychedelics for brain health, even as the NFL's drug policies currently do not prohibit most classical psychedelics.
